Output a3435c103643034455dec9d591a07e7755745af3007ff1f199b695e865120b06:2

value
43655208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4386ab91acaef735e8fc2240c35937572ddc27 OP_EQUAL
address
MHmc6wVxEUPktTvBhTWZCS9zNo26MX6eEk
transaction
a3435c103643034455dec9d591a07e7755745af3007ff1f199b695e865120b06
spent
true